Borderline by Ray McKinley And His Orchestra released in 1955 on Savoy

Ray McKinley (June 18, 1910 – May 7, 1995) was an American jazz drummer, singer, and bandleader. He played drums and later led the Major Glenn Miller Army Air Forces Orchestra in Europe. He also led the new Glenn Miller Orchestra in 1956. - Wikipedia

Top swing tunes featuring:

Alto Saxophone – Ray Beller
Arranged By – Eddie Sauter
Clarinet – Peanuts Hucko
Drums – Ray McKinley
Guitar – Mundell Lowe
Piano – Lou Stein
Tenor Saxophone – Bud Freeman
Trombone – Vern Friley
Trumpet – Charles Genduso, Nick Travis, Rusty Dedrick
